Duke University was created in 1924 through an indenture of trust by James Buchanan Duke. Today, Duke is regarded as one of America’s leading research universities. Located in Durham, North Carolina, Duke is positioned in the heart of the Research Triangle, which is ranked annually as one of the best places in the country to work and live. Duke has more than 15,000 students who study and conduct research in its 10 undergraduate, graduate and professional schools. With about 40,000 employees, Duke is the third largest private employer in North Carolina, and it now has international programs in more than 150 countries.

Occupational Summary

 

We are seeking a highly organized and detail-oriented individual to join our team as an Adjunct/NRR Hiring Process and HR Coordinator. The ideal candidate will manage various aspects of the hiring process for adjunct instructors, assist with faculty searches and interviews, coordinate payroll, oversee the recruitment process for research positions, manage HR communications, and coordinate school-wide events. This role requires excellent communication skills, strong administrative capabilities, and the ability to manage multiple tasks simultaneously.  This position will report to the HR Director and the Manager of Faculty Affairs.

 

This is a full-time, non-exempt position that will require at least 3 days of in-person work per week.

 

Work Performed

 

Adjunct/Non-Regular Rank Hiring Process: (35%)

  • Collect information from centers and programs regarding courses they will be offering each semester.
  • Create marketing materials and postings for external sites.
  • Prepare contract letters for instructors using templates and mail merge.
  • Obtain approval for contract letters from centers, programs, and the Finance and Administration Dean.
  • Email letters to instructors, track their return, and ensure they are signed.
  • File returned letters in the shared drive and share them with Sanford HR and Faculty Affairs.

 

Faculty Affairs Assistance: (10%)

  • Provided logistical support to the Faculty Affairs Manager related to appointments, reviews and reappointments.
  • Assist search committees by booking interviews with semifinalist candidates.
  • Prepare and finalize semifinalist interview schedules for the search committee.

 

On-Site Assistance for Flyouts: (5%)

  • Serve as the onsite coordinator for search finalists visiting campus.
  • Arrange catering, transportation, hotel, and AV setups for candidate presentations.
  • Book restaurants for faculty dinners and breakfast meetings.

 

Payroll & Operational Support (25%):

      •  
  • Oversees the electronic timecard processes for exempt and non-exempt and students.  Monitors the timely and accurate submission of timecards, runs reports and identifies and monitors and resolves problematic compensation payments for staff and student through the interface with Duke Corporate Payroll Services and Duke departments as needed.
  • Verifies, audits, and confirms personnel and payroll actions for completeness, accuracy, timing, and conformity to budget and policy guidelines; makes recommendations and processes forms as appropriate for non-exempt and exempt staff.
  • Anticipates, identifies and works to resolve potential payroll problems to minimize the financial and operational impact to the school.
  • Maintain paypoints, perform regular audits
